1

我试图围绕 collectd 如何报告每个指定时间段的指标。

例如,我将报告间隔设置为 10 秒,因此它每 10 秒采样一次。因此,如果我在网络接口上收到 500K 的度量,自上次采样以来的 10 秒时间段内总共收到 500K,还是在 collectd 采样时的那一秒内收到 500K?

(上下文):我想了解 Graphite 中 collectd.iface.* 指标上的值是否报告为每 10 秒的八位字节(在这种情况下,我必须除以 10 才能获得真正的八位字节/秒值),还是已经是八位字节/秒(在这种情况下,平均是什么?Collectd 还是 Graphite?)

先感谢您。

4

1 回答 1

1

您的里程可能会有所不同,如果没有看到更多细节,我不能说更多。我能说的是“接口”插件正在报告计数器。这意味着您有以下两种解决方案之一:

  1. 配置插件以将计数器转换为费率:通常使用“StoreRates”选项来实现

  2. 配置输出插件以发送原始计数器(通常是默认值),并配置石墨以计算渲染 API 中的导数(我不记得确切的选项名称)

于 2014-09-04T19:20:39.050 回答